East Peckham

Situated 8 miles East of Tonbridge, East Peckham was the centre for the Hop growing industry in Kent and is still home to the much visited Hop Farm which has the worlds largest collected of Oast Houses.

Originally the village was located much closer to West Peckham, but slowly the centre of the village moved closer to the River Medway. Subsequently, East Peckham like Yalding, is well known for suffering from flooding, defences have recently been built to help mitergate the effects of these (see flooding).

Walter Arnold, from East Peckham, received notoriety as the first person in Britain to be successfully prosecuted for speeding - travelling at four times the speed limit (actually just 8 mph, as the speed limit at the time was just 2mph!). He was fined 1 shilling, plus costs.  Caught by policeman who gave chase on bicycle. Somehow one can't imagine a bicycling policeman today managing to catch (or even keep up with) a speeding car – how times have changed.
